The musical Fiddler On The Roof, starring Zero Mostel, is performed at The Majestic Theatre, Broadway, New York City, USA. It will run continuously (but at three different theatres) until 1972 notching up 3,242 performances.
The musical Hallelujah Baby!, starring Leslie Uggams, is presented at The Martin Beck Theatre, Broadway, New York City, USA, during a run of 293 performances.
Fiddler On The Roof, starring Luther Adler and Dolores Wilson, is running during a lengthy engagement at McVickers Theatre, Chicago, Illinois, USA.
Quicksilver Messenger Service play the second of three nights at the Both/And Club, San Francisco, California, USA.
The Beatles undertake the second of several recording sessions for the song You Know My Name (Look Up The Number) in Abbey Road studios, London, England, UK, Europe. At this session they record intrumental tracks only.

Pink Floyd have an Abbey Road Studios, London, UK, recording session, working on Matilda Mother, Chapter 24 and Flaming.
Three members of San Francisco, California, USA, band Moby Grape are found with schoolgirls in the back of their car and are arrested for "contributing to the delinquency of minors."
